H5P.com (LTI Tool Provider Setup)
OpenLearning supports multiple technologies to provide interoperability with other systems, tools, and apps. In this article, we will be covering the Learning Tools Interoperability (LTI) integration with H5P.com, an open-source content collaboration framework that aims to make it easy for everyone to create, share and reuse interactive HTML5 content such as interactive videos, interactive presentations, quizzes, interactive timelines and more within an LMS.
This integration is quite useful, as it will allow you to export out reports that capture the results, attempts, timestamps etc of each user that interacted with the uploaded content from your H5P.com account page.
Pre-requisite
- A portal subscription with us in order to set up this integration for your courses.
- Paid H5P.com plan
Setting up H5P with LTI integration
Step 1
Log In to H5P.com and click on Manage Organization.
Step 2
Navigate to Connect LMS and select these values:
- Select your LMS: Other
- Connection Name: Any string is acceptable but we suggest naming this to OpenLearning
- LTI Version: LTI v.1.1
Step 3
Click Save. This will generate the details needed for the integration.
Take note of the URL Endpoint for LTI v.1.1, Key and Secret as you need this later when setting up the integration on the platform.
Setting up H5P.com Integration in Portal
Step 1
Log in to OpenLearning and navigate to your Institution Settings > Integrations.
Step 2
Scroll down to the LTI Tool Providers section and click on + Add LTI tool provider.
Step 3
Enter the tool provider name, and on the Tool provider registration section, select LTI 1.1 for the LTI version.
Note: We'll release a separate documentation for setting this up for with H5P LTI 1.3.
Step 4
Enter the name H5P as the tool provider name, and the details below:
- Launch URL : URL Endpoint that you took note from H5P
- Consumer Key : Key that you took note from H5P
- Shared Secret : Secret that you took note earlier from H5P
Note: The widget icon will automatically be updated automatically once the correct Launch URL is added to the section above.
Step 5
Check Deep Linking in the Tool Settings to ensure a tighter integration with the H5P.com tool set.
Step 6
Click Save. If the integration is successful, you will see the the word Enabled with a green dot below it.
Adding the H5P LTI tool to a course
Step 1
On your preferred course page, click on the Edit button to go into Edit mode.
Step 2
Go to the Widget menu and select Integration from the category dropdown.
Step 3
Click or drag the H5P widget icon onto your page as with any other widget.
Step 4
Select the H5P Setup tab and if you have an existing activity on H5P.com which you would like to use, you can select it here.
Otherwise, use the H5P Add Content button to create a new activity.
Step 5
When you have finished creating or selecting H5P.com content, click the Save or Save and Insert button.
Create a Quiz with H5P.com
Step 1
Click Add Content and select the Quiz (Question Set) option to create a new quiz.
Step 2
Add a title to your quiz.
Step 3
Create your questions by first choosing the question type from the drop-down menu.
Step 4
Next, simply create your questions by adding the title of your question, the question itself and adding the different answer options.
Step 5
To add more questions click on the + Add Question button.
Step 5
Scroll down, click on LTI Settings and select an option from the Choose when to send scores back to LMS from the drop-down menu.
- Do not send score - do not send the score to OpenLearning
- First attempt - capture the first attempt and send it to OpenLearning
- Last attempt - capture the last attempt and send it to OpenLearning
- Best attempt - capture the best attempt and send it to OpenLearning
This will send a score between 0.0 and 1.0 (where 1.0 is 100%) back to OpenLearning. (excluding the first option - do not send score)
Step 6
This score can be used to automatically set completion for a learner using the Completion Settings tab, where a score threshold can be provided.
Administrator's View
As an administrator of the course that has been added to the H5P.com plan, it will allow you to add, create and edit the H5P content directly from the widget.
What you see in the view mode will differ slightly from the learner's view as well; you can Edit the content and gather Reports on the activity and download the H5P content to your device directly from the widget as well.
Learner's View
As a learner, you can just view and interact with the content that has been added to the widget by the course administrator.